Peltier Thermoelectric Modules - Thermal-Cycling

uwe electronic’s 70-series has been specifically designed for cycling applications. Tests show TEM life time is significantly greater than a standard module under the same thermal cycling conditions. Typical application areas include instrumentation, chillers, PCR cyclers and analyzers. These TEMs are also available with different configurations.

Peltier Hot Side / Cold Side
Type 2 (T2) TEMs feature a "porch" for more accurate heat distribution.
This makes the L2 dimensions slightly longer than the L1 dimension.

Imax:Maximum input current in amperes at Qc=0 and ΔTmax
Vmax:Maximum DC input voltage in volts at Qc=0 and ΔTmax
ΔTmax:Maximum temperature differential in °C at Qc=0 and Imax
Qcmax:Maximum heat pumping capacity in watts at Imax and ΔT=0
T hot:Temperature of TEM hot side during operation
